Output 08d3b13c8af2eeac0c9ee4e5b914f021121a8ac80155ed4c2b9c3e7378f38f26:9

value
16644000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64154973dd734bbfd447428f3037cc9de9239d11 OP_EQUALVERIFY OP_CHECKSIG
address
1A8C5E26u7GDS42hNpGZUoQ21ZCPfVv34Y
transaction
08d3b13c8af2eeac0c9ee4e5b914f021121a8ac80155ed4c2b9c3e7378f38f26
confirmations
325589
spent
true